HFEM Academy successfully conducted the Ergonomics Risk Assessment Level 2: Advanced training at Bangi Resort Hotel, focusing on practical ergonomic risk assessment methods including REBA, RULA, ROSA, MAC, RAPP, and ART. Led by Dr Ahmad Khushairy, the training provided participants with practical knowledge and skills to identify, assess, and manage ergonomic risks across various workplace activities.
